~Cheet Sheets CD 1 !D-ROM.PCX TITLE : CHEET SHEETS : THE CD-ROM COLLECTION - VOLUME 1 (CD-ROM) PRICE : œ20.00 Including recorded delivery (UK-only) PUBLISHER : Eurowave Leisure Ltd 0171 251 4888 and Wayne Roberts (Editor of cheet sheets). SOFTWARE TYPE : Magazine Database + Various Other Software SYSTEM REQUIRED : 386 PC with VGA, mouse, 2MB Ram, Dos 5.0 RECOMMENDED SYSTEM : 486 or higher, with 4/8MB of ram, only essential for high quality sound output. REVIEWED BY : ADRIANO MAURIZIO GRISANTI REVIEW : The cheet sheets CD-ROM, comes with its own plastic case, proper CD sleeve, instructions & pressed CD-ROM disc. What is cheet sheets I hear you all cry, well its a monthly disk-based magazine, and your reading it right now, nice isn't it. As you can see it has various reviews, articles and cheets, with a user friendly interface. The CD version of cheet sheets includes over 800 solutions, hints, tips or help on PC Games. These cheets and tips include Maps and Graphical solutions. The CD also has over 150 game reviews and includes a special compiled version of issues 1-34 of the original monthly disk based version. Besides the great stuff mentioned above, the cd also contains the original magazine in its original disk format, over 200 MOD files and players (including GMOD, cheet sheets own MOD player), pictures, 180 shareware games, many doom levels & the Gorin Organiser for Dos and Windows (graphical interface). The GMOD player included, allows the choice of low, medium or high quality output and is very user friendly. Altogether I'll give the cheet sheets CD 9.5/10 as it is a very useful and entertaining CD, and at a very sensible price, "BUY IT TODAY" & support cheet sheets. Comments : The cheet sheets CD is excellent, bar that there is no actual music in the actual compiled version, instead the mods have to be played through a separate MOD player. This is a good idea, but it would be best if some mods were included in the compiled mag, maybe next time ?. That why only 9.5/10. Thanks for the review, I'd just luike to comment on your final query concerning the lack of sound in the CD version. Well this was left out purposely so as we could reach a wider range of users. Having the sound in the interface would have slowed the program right down and of course it doesn't use up as much memory when running, so all those 1Mbyte and 2Mbyte users could still use it !!!!
